Hi! > 12 марта 2019 г., в 10:22, Andrey Borodin <[email protected]> написал(а): > > 3. And I'd use memmove despite the comment why we do not do that. It is > SSE-optimized and cache-optimized nowadays.
So, I've pushed idea a little bit and showed that decompress byte-copy cycle to
Vladimir Leskov.
while (len--)
{
*dp = dp[-off];
dp++;
}
He advised me to use algorithm that splits copied regions into smaller
non-overlapping subregions with exponentially increasing size.
while (off <= len)
{
memcpy(dp, dp - off, off);
len -= off;
dp += off;
off *= 2;
}
memcpy(dp, dp - off, len);
On original Paul's test without patch of this thread this optimization gave
about x2.5 speedup.
I've composed more detailed tests[0] and tested against current master. Now it
only gives 20%-25% of decompression speedup, but I think it is still useful.
